Output 77db11f17998e25ab75c54c1a89adeedc5a0e19148f325a129c55b6665e38e09:0

value
859300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1341360873095c0e7d66c1816e70dfc2904598 OP_EQUAL
address
3MqxKnDbFpJ9ZcN5FcZaQWRi2EukVVDLY9
transaction
77db11f17998e25ab75c54c1a89adeedc5a0e19148f325a129c55b6665e38e09
spent
true